Local Buyer Guide

How to compare Garage Door Companies in Grand Rapids, MI

Start by comparing response times for emergency spring and opener failures, hardware warranties, and whether technicians stock cold-rated rollers and seals on the truck. Weigh repair versus replacement costs, opener horsepower for heavier insulated doors, and insulation values that matter in West Michigan’s temperature swings. Clear pricing for same-day calls and proof of insurance should be non-negotiable.

Local Price Guide

Typical Garage Doors Prices in Grand Rapids

Use these Grand Rapids, MI garage doors price ranges as rough planning estimates. Final quotes can change with project scope, access, materials, permits, timing, and company pricing.

Quick pricing notes

  • Use these as planning ranges, not final quotes.
  • Ask what labor, materials, permits, cleanup, and timing include.
  • Compare the same project scope with two or three local companies.
Service Typical Estimated Cost
Garage Door Replacement Door, tracks, hardware, and installation $950 - $5,600 Per Project
Garage Door Repair Garage door diagnosis and repair $125 - $950 Per Visit
Garage Door Opener Installation Opener unit and installation $300 - $1,200 Per Project
Garage Door Opener Replacement Opener replacement and setup $250 - $1,000 Per Project
Garage Door Spring Replacement Spring replacement and balancing $150 - $950 Per Project
Garage Door Track Repair Track repair and alignment $125 - $475 Per Visit
Garage Door Cable Repair Cable repair and door balancing $125 - $650 Per Visit

Prices are general estimates only. Contact a local service company for an accurate quote for your home and project. See full garage doors price guide.

Area-specific

Local Considerations

  • Cold winters and freeze‑thaw stress on springs, rollers, and seals
  • Insulation (R‑value) and tight weatherstripping to reduce heat loss
  • Opener horsepower suited to heavier insulated doors
  • Salt and slush exposure requiring corrosion‑resistant hardware
Before you hire

Homeowner Guidance

  • Ask for itemized quotes showing parts brands, spring cycle ratings, and labor warranty.
  • Confirm technicians carry multiple spring sizes and cold‑rated rollers for same‑visit fixes.
  • Compare repair vs. replacement when panels are rusted or the opener is underpowered.
  • Request a balance test and safety sensor check after any service.
  • Schedule annual tune‑ups before winter to lubricate, adjust, and replace worn seals.
